什么是Shadowsocks Native?
Shadowsocks Native 是一款基于Shadowsocks协议的网络代理工具,旨在为用户提供更为安全与隐私的上网体验。作为一款开源的代理工具,Shadowsocks Native具备轻量级、高性能以及高度可定制化的特点,适合各种使用场景,尤其是在需要翻墙的情况下。
Shadowsocks Native的特点
- 轻量级设计:Shadowsocks Native的核心代码相对简洁,因此占用系统资源极少。
- 高性能:通过使用UDP协议,Shadowsocks Native可以实现更快的传输速度。
- 安全性:支持多种加密方式,确保用户数据的隐私安全。
- 跨平台支持:不仅支持Windows、Linux、macOS等桌面系统,还可以在Android和iOS移动设备上使用。
Shadowsocks Native的安装步骤
Windows平台安装
- 下载Shadowsocks Native的最新版本。
- 解压下载的压缩包。
- 双击运行
Shadowsocks.exe
。 - 在程序界面中配置代理服务器地址和端口。
- 设置完成后,点击“启动”按钮。
Linux平台安装
-
通过终端进入下载目录。
-
使用以下命令解压下载的包: bash tar -zxvf shadowsocks-linux.tar.gz
-
进入解压后的文件夹: bash cd shadowsocks-linux
-
使用以下命令启动Shadowsocks服务: bash ./shadowsocks-server -s <server_ip>:<server_port> -k
-m
macOS平台安装
- 下载macOS版本的Shadowsocks Native。
- 拖动应用程序到“应用程序”文件夹中。
- 启动应用程序并进行相应的配置。
Android和iOS平台安装
- 在各大应用商店中搜索并下载Shadowsocks应用。
- 安装完成后,打开应用并进行服务器的配置。
如何配置Shadowsocks Native
服务器配置
- 在Shadowsocks Native的界面中输入服务器地址、端口、密码及加密方法。
- 确保填写的内容准确无误,以确保连接成功。
客户端设置
- 选择代理模式,可以选择全局模式或分应用模式。
- 设置本地端口和其他相关选项,以适应个人需求。
启动服务
- 完成配置后,点击“启动”按钮以启动代理服务。
- 在状态栏中可以查看连接状态及网络流量。
Shadowsocks Native的使用场景
- 翻墙上网:通过Shadowsocks Native访问被封锁的网站。
- 保护隐私:在公共Wi-Fi环境中,使用Shadowsocks Native加密网络流量。
- 科学上网:访问国外资源,提升下载和浏览速度。
Shadowsocks Native常见问题解答
如何解决连接问题?
- 检查输入的服务器地址和端口是否正确。
- 确保防火墙未阻止Shadowsocks的网络连接。
- 尝试更换加密方法或端口。
Shadowsocks Native支持哪些加密方式?
- Shadowsocks Native支持多种加密方式,包括但不限于:AES-256-GCM、ChaCha20等。
我可以同时使用多个Shadowsocks Native客户端吗?
- 是的,您可以在不同的设备上使用多个Shadowsocks Native客户端,但需要确保每个客户端配置不同的本地端口。
如何测试Shadowsocks的速度?
- 使用在线速度测试工具,或通过Ping测试,查看连接的延迟及速度。
结论
Shadowsocks Native是一款非常强大的网络代理工具,具有高性能和安全性,适合广泛的用户需求。无论是用于翻墙上网、保护隐私,还是获取更快的网络连接,Shadowsocks Native都能提供优质的服务。通过本文的安装和配置指南,用户可以轻松上手,享受安全、快速的网络体验。
正文完